U.S. equity markets experienced a sharp downturn on Monday, driven by a sweeping selloff in AI-linked stocks. The Nasdaq Composite was the hardest hit among the major indexes as shares of companies building and supplying AI infrastructure tumbled, many by double-digit percentages. Nvidia, the chip giant at the center of the AI boom, saw its stock fall 16% during the session, according to market data. The catalyst was the emergence of DeepSeek, a Chinese AI model that reportedly achieved comparable performance to leading U.S. models at a fraction of the development cost. This development challenged the prevailing narrative that U.S. companies hold an unassailable lead in AI, and it sparked fears that the massive capital expenditures poured into AI infrastructure may not yield the expected returns. Other firms in the AI supply chain, such as data-center operators and semiconductor equipment makers, also suffered steep losses. The broad-based decline underscored the market’s sensitivity to any shift in competitive dynamics within the rapidly evolving AI sector. The key takeaway from Monday’s rout is that the AI investment thesis, which has powered much of the market’s recent gains, now faces a new layer of uncertainty. DeepSeek’s emergence suggests that low-cost AI alternatives from China could potentially undercut the pricing power and margins of U.S. leaders like Nvidia. If more efficient AI models reduce the need for vast computing clusters, demand for high-end chips and related infrastructure might slow, putting pressure on revenue forecasts across the ecosystem. Additionally, the selloff highlights how geopolitical competition in technology can rapidly alter market expectations. Investors may now reassess the premium valuations assigned to AI stocks, especially those with heavy exposure to hardware and data-center buildout. The event also signals that the AI race is global and that technological breakthroughs can happen anywhere, adding a layer of risk that was perhaps previously underestimated by market participants. From an investment perspective, the DeepSeek-driven selloff suggests that the AI sector may face increased volatility as competitive dynamics evolve. While the long-term demand for AI capabilities remains robust, the cost efficiency of newer models could shift the balance of winners and losers. Companies relying on proprietary chips and expensive cloud infrastructure might need to adapt to a world where leaner models gain traction. For broader markets, the rout serves as a reminder that concentrated bets on a few high-flying themes carry substantial downside risk. Diversification and careful scrutiny of valuation assumptions become more important when a single news event can erase hundreds of billions in market value. Investors should monitor how established AI firms respond to this competitive challenge and whether they can defend their technological moats. The full impact on earnings and capital spending plans may not be clear until upcoming quarterly reports are released.
